The Project Management Office (PMO) Assistant provides day\-to\-day administrative and coordination support to the PMO team, helping to keep initiatives, reporting routines and governance activities running smoothly. The role supports the preparation of key materials (actions, logs, trackers, packs and minutes), maintains core PMO data, and helps ensure stakeholders receive timely, accurate communications. Working across the Systems Execution business, the PMO Assistant contributes to improved visibility, consistency and continuous improvement by enabling the PMO team to operate efficiently.
This is a hands\-on coordination role requiring strong organisation, attention to detail, and confidence working with multiple stakeholders, systems and deadlines.
- *PRINCIPLE D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ES**
- Coordinate PMO routines (meeting schedules, agendas, packs, minutes and action tracking) and ensure follow\-ups are completed on time
- Maintain PMO trackers and registers as required
- Analyse project performance data as required to help identify root causes and generate learning opportunities
- Prepare and format presentations, templates and communications to support PMO initiatives (standard tools, guidance notes, onboarding content)
- Coordinate workshops and stakeholder sessions (invites, logistics, pre\-reads, notes, actions) and support deployment activities
- Support administration of key tools and processes (IDEF’s) as required
- Handle confidential information with discretion and operate in compliance with internal policies and controls
